Job description Job responsibilities

Core Clinical Responsibilities

Manage face-to-face, telephone, and remote/video patient consultations.

Diagnose and treat acute and chronic illnesses.

Make safe, independent decisions and create patient care plans.

Prescribe medications and handle repeat prescription requests.

Make appropriate clinical referrals to secondary or community care.

Complete occasional home visits if deemed clinically necessary.

Administration and Governance

Process lab results, clinical letters, and workflow tasks promptly.

Maintain accurate, contemporaneous patient records using clinical system EMIS Web .

Engage in clinical governance, audits, and Quality Outcomes Framework (QOF) workflows.

Attend internal practice meetings and multidisciplinary team (MDT) updates.

Professional Requirements

Full GMC registration with a license to practice and entry on the UK GP Register.

Inclusion on a local NHS Medical Performers List.

Commitment to ongoing Continuing Professional Development (CPD) and annual appraisals

Disclosure and Barring Service Check This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
